As anticipation builds for the 2026 FIFA World Cup across the USA, Canada, and Mexico, new reports indicate that attending the final match could come with an exorbitant price tag for some supporters. Figures circulating suggest that certain ticket packages for the showpiece event might reach up to £24,000, sparking debate among football fans worldwide.
This potential pricing structure has led to concerns that the tournament, set to be the largest ever with 48 competing nations, could become inaccessible for many dedicated fans. Critics argue that such high costs could alienate a significant portion of the global football community, potentially turning the event into an exclusive experience rather than a celebration for all.
While official pricing details for all tiers of tickets have yet to be fully released by FIFA, these early reports highlight the financial pressures that attendees might face.
